		<description>No Offense, but these ideas are lame! I&#039;ve been to 8 year olds parties that are better than all of these ideas put together. Now this would be fun(except I can&#039;t do it because it&#039;s VERY costly; but it&#039;s my dream birthday)
1) Rent a Limo and tell all the people you are inviting to come fancy. 
2) Have the limo drive the teens around and then go a fancy restaurant and eat. 
3) After that, go to a hotel and rent a suite and a couple of rooms with 2 beds and a pull out couch.
4) There, you can have a scavenger hunt around the hotel and if the hotel has an indoor swimming pool, you can swim usually to midnight.
5) After you get back to your room, have a movie, dancing or a spa, then cut the cake.
6) Make sure it&#039;s a cool cake, maybe like a topsy turvy cake(NOT HOMEMADE) with an awesome design matching the theme of the party.
7) in the morning, have breakfast at the hotel
8) Have the people&#039;s parents pick them up at the hotel
whoa whoa
now that&#039;s a party!!!!</description>
